Nature of our service

Solstice Aviation operates as an advisory charter broker. We act as an intermediary between clients and third-party aircraft operators. We are not ourselves party to any contract between a client and an operator, and we do not operate aircraft.

We receive commission from operators when we make a successful introduction. This commission-based structure means that, in the Civil Aviation Authority's published position, we are not making available flight accommodation for the purposes of the Civil Aviation (Air Travel Organisers' Licensing) Regulations 2012, and we do not hold an ATOL licence. Charter contracts are between the client and the operating company.

This website collects enquiries only. Submitting an enquiry or sending a contact form does not create a booking, reservation, or any contractual commitment. A charter is only confirmed once trip details, commercial terms, and operator availability have been agreed directly.
